Who we are.
New Age Kurlers are people from the village and surrounding villages, male and female, and of all ages and abilities. We have facilities for wheelchair users.
What we do.
Kurling is a bit like indoor bowls and a bit like curling on ice, we play on the floor of the village hall. ‘Stones’ are pushed onto a target, with the nearest stone to the centre being the winner. We play individually, in teams of two and teams of four sometimes.
Why we do it
We are a friendly, sociable club and have found kurling has a great community spirit and is a way of making new friends. We go to play friendly matches against other villages. Members can play at any level, entering competitions all over the country if you want to take it further – even the World Championships.
